JVP MP blames Sri Lanka govt for charging mobile phone tax from female hostellers at Colombo University
ColomboPage November 26th, 2007Nov 27, Colombo: JVP MP Vijitha Herath at Parliament yesterday accused the government of charging Rs. 200 from female hostellers at Colombo University as a tax for keeping mobile phones.
